Feb 3 (Reuters) - A rate hike expected from the European Central Bank again in March is likely not to be the last, with the bank's fight with inflation far from over, ECB policymaker Peter Kazimir said on Friday. "I don't think the March hike will be the last. We will decide subsequently how many more will be needed," he said in a statement.


"The battle against inflation is far from won and it will be months before we can say with confidence that we have steered inflation where it belongs." (Reporting by Robert Muller in Prague)
